About the Community House Located in Winnetka, IL, the Community House is a unique and historic wedding destination. Established in 1911, this building is a delightful getaway in Chicagoland. The Tudor Revival-style building has hosted many exceptional occasions since its inception and joined the National Register of Historic Places in the year 2007. Conveniently situated in the North Shore, the Community House is also home to an easily accessible and stunning heritage garden.
